The Rotating Vane Head
The rotating vane head of the RVD contains the velocity and temperature
sensors along with stored calibration data. When using the rotating vane head,
make sure the blades are free to move and the flow arrow points along the air
flow path.
WARNING!
Be sure to turn the meter off before connecting or
disconnecting rotating vane heads. Do
not
expose the
vane head to excessive heat; it can damage the vane
head.
Attaching the Handle
To attach the handle, screw the handle into the bottom of the rotating vane
head until secure.
Using the Articulating Extension
The articulating extension allows you to secure the vane head at nearly any
angle. Once you have attached the articulating extension to the vane head
and handle, you can then unscrew the angle adjustment bolt and adjust the
angle of the elbow. You can also adjust the rotation of the head by partially
unscrewing the head from the handle and tightening it with the knurled
knob, located underneath the vane head.
Using the Optional Small Vane Head
The smaller optional rotating vane head is primarily intended for tests with
constricted flow area or those difficult to reach. The small rotating vane
head functions like the large vane head. With the unit turned off, unplug the
large head from the instrument and plug in the small head and then turn the
unit on again.
